Which Is Healthier For You?

Alternative types of milks.

It all depends on what you’re looking for. If you have cow milk or soy allergies then the answer is pretty obvious – whichever milk you don’t have an allergy to.

The only thing you should look at in the plant based milks is the sugar content to make sure that it doesn’t have a high total sugar content.

This can happen when the manufacturer adds additional sugar to satisfy the sweet tooth of the American public. I buy “unsweetened” milk and I would suggest you

do that too.

My personal favorite plant based milk is coconut milk and my second choice is soy milk. But you can try them out and see what you like. Or you can stay with cow’s milk as there are really no studies that show any downside to it (unless you’re allergic to it like I am).
